3080 and OLED? Here are my tips to get a locked 40hz RT experience
Use CRU to add a 40hz mode to your screen.

Mod the game to use 40fps with in game frame limiter (very important! do not use other limiter tools or nvidia control panel, MOD the game to get smoothest possible). The display.xml file in bin\config\r4game\user_config_matrix\pc\ find the FPS Limit attribute and add your own entry

Set everything to High/Ultra (No Ultra+). Pay special attention to VRAM. You may only have 10GB, in which case run the textures on at most High.

Grab RT optimized quality mode mod from nexus.

DLSS to balanced or performance at 4k.

Enjoy game with RT at locked 40fps on 3080*

If you cant get a 40hz mode working, you can do the same with 30hz.
Don't bother going higher unless you want to deal with stutters and dips in the big cities due to CPU bottlenecks

* Assuming your CPU is up to it
